PFAS REACH Annex XV Restriction Report 1ST Public Consultation (22 March - 25 September 2023) Exclusion of Trifluoroacetic Acid from the PFAS Proposal for a Restriction General Comments: Sinochem Lantian Fluoro Materials Co., Ltd. is a company mainly engaged in fluorinated polymers and fluorinated fine chemicals. Fluorinated fine chemicals include 1,1,1-trichloro-2,2,2-trifluoroethane, trifluoroacetyl chloride, trifluoroacetic acid (TFA), ethyl trifluoroacetate and other related derivative products of TFA. The production of TFA is globally leading. Our company supports the EU's efforts to reduce the risk of hazardous substances and believes it is necessary to reduce the use of PFAS. But we consider that TFA should be excluded from the PFAS proposal, because of the irreplaceable role of TFA in the production process of pharmaceutical and pesticides. There are two reasons to support this view. Firstly, the Dossier Submitter of PFAS Proposal from five national authorities consider that the derogation covers all preceding steps that are necessary to produce the product, including pharmaceuticals and pesticides that complied with relevant EU regulations. But there is no specific definition of necessary production. As all know, CF3-containing pharmaceuticals and pesticides play a critical role in global market. Currently, the main raw materials for large-scale production of CF3-containing aliphatic and heteroaromatic products are TFA and related derivatives, which are difficult to replace with other raw materials or synthesis methods. In addition, TFA could also be used as reaction solvent, analytical reagent, protective reagent, and deprotective reagent, which are widely used in production of pharmaceuticals and pesticides. Therefore, TFA should be considered as a critical part of necessary production and excluded from the production of pharmaceuticals and pesticides. CF3-containing pharmaceuticals and pesticides play a critical role in human health and food safety. According to statistical data from Jon T. Njardarson group[1]i, there were five CF3-containing products with a total sale of 14.8 billion USD and a proportion of 8.9%, among the top50 small molecule pharmaceuticals by retail sales in 2020, including enzalutamide, sitagliptin, sitagliptin/metformin combination, teriflunomide, and nilotinib. According to statistical data from Phillips McDougall[2]ii, there were also five CF3-containing products with a total sale of 2.7 billion USD and a proportion of 8.4%, among the top45 pesticides (fungicides, insecticides, herbicides) by sales in 2020, including trifloxystrobin, picoxystrobin, cyhalothrin, fipronil, and bifenthrin. In the production process of pharmaceuticals and pesticides, there are three main methods for introducing trifluoromethyl into molecules. The first one is chlorination and then fluorination of methyl on molecules. This method has limitations such as use of toxic gases (Cl2 and HF), high requirements for equipment, and low chemical selectivity. The second method is using trifluoromethylation reagents such as halogenated trifluoromethane, TMSCF3, Togni reagent, Langlois reagent, and Umemoto reagent. This method can regioselectively introduce trifluoromethyl into molecular, but there are limitations such as expensive reagents, poor atomic economy, harsh reaction conditions, and difficulty in large-scale production. The third method is using TFA and related derivatives as raw materials to construct target molecules through functional group conversion or carbon-carbon bond formation. This method has the advantages of good selectivity, mild conditions, high yield, and low cost. It is currently the main method for large-scale production of CF3-containing aliphatic and heteroaromatic products, which is difficult to be replaced by other raw materials or synthesis methods. According to statistics, the global consumption of TFA and related derivatives reached 40000 tons in 2022 and maintained a strong growth trend, with an expected average annual growth of 1500 tons/year. There are several typical examples as follows: 1.1 Pharmaceutical production Nirmatrelvir is one of active ingredients in the anti COVID-19 drug Paxlovid, which was approve by EMA in 2022[3]iii. In the same year, the global sale of Paxlovid is 18.9 billion USD, ranking 1st in global best-selling small molecule pharmaceuticals. The patented synthesis route of nirmatrelvir is to first construct a trifluoroacetamide group using ethyl trifluoroacetate as the raw material, and then synthesize the target molecule through multi-step reactions[4]iv. There is no industrialized alternative route so far. Sitagliptin is a commonly used diabetes drug authorized by HMA[5]v. In 2022, the global sale of sitagliptin is 2.8 billion USD, ranking 23rd in global best-selling small molecule pharmaceuticals. The patented synthesis route of sitagliptin is to first construct trifluoromethyl oxadiazole intermediate using ethyl trifluoroacetate as raw material, and then synthesize the target molecule through multi-step reactions[6]vi. There is no industrialized alternative route so far. 1.2 Pesticide production Flufenacet is a herbicide developed by Bayer and authorized by the European Commission[7]vii. The global sale is 0.25 billion USD in 2019. Flufenacet is widely used in many countries all over the world, including the EU. The patented synthesis route of flufenacet is to first construct trifluoromethyl thiadiazole intermediate using TFA as raw material, and then synthesize the target molecule through multi-step reactions[8]viii. There is no industrialized alternative route so far. Sulfoxaflor is a neonicotinoid insecticide developed by Corteva and authorized by the European Union. The global sale is 0.19 billion USD in 2019. Sulfoxaflor has become an alternative product of traditional neonicotinoid insecticides due to low bee toxicity. The patented synthesis route of sulfoxaflor is to first construct trifluoromethyl pyridine intermediate using trifluoroacetyl chloride as raw material, and then synthesize the target molecule through multi-step reactions[9]ix. There is no industrialized alternative route so far. 1.3 Other application In the production process of pharmaceuticals and pesticides, TFA could not only be used as the raw material, but also as reaction solvent, analytical reagent (such as HPLC mobile phase), deprotection reagent for protective groups, and protective reagent for amino groups. Trifluoromethyl functional group is widely used in the design and development of pharmaceuticals and pesticides due to its strong electron withdrawing ability, which can change the charge distribution and configuration of molecules, thereby affecting their physical and chemical properties and enhancing biological activity. In the field of drug development, trifluoromethyl is often used to improve the cell membrane permeability and pharmacokinetic properties of drugs, such as increasing oral bioavailability and reducing liver metabolism. The interaction between drug molecule and target enzyme could be enhanced, while the activity and selectivity of drug improved by introducing trifluoromethyl[10].2] For example, during the discovery of sitagliptin, when the substituent R is trifluoromethyl, its activity is significantly higher than H, ethyl, perfluoroethyl and other substituents[11.T] able 6 Inhibitory activity of sitagliptin derivatives on target enzymes Another example is the discovery of nirmatrelvir. The antiviral activity has been significantly improved by 10 times by the replacement of the methanesulfonyl with trifluoroacetyl on the amino group[12. ] In the field of pesticidedevelopment, trifluoromethyl is often used as a bioisostere of halogen, cyano, and short chain alkyl groups in the molecular design to enhance the activity and persistence[13if]. For example, the fungicide picoxystrobin is optimized based on the structure of kresoxim-methyl. According to statistical data from FDA[153], there are 19 new CF- containing products with a proportion of 9.3%, among 205 new small molecule pharmaceuticals approved by the FDA from 2016 to 2021. According to statistical data from the British Crop Protection Council (BCPC)[163333 . O, d3 P., there are 21 new CF-containing products with a proportion of 34.4%, among the 61 new pesticides that received ISO common names from 2016 to 2021. Moreover, there are still many new CF-containing pharmaceuticals and pesticides in the product development pipeline, while companies have invested a lot of manpower and resources in the early stage.
